Summary:  Incorrect method of merging arrays

Original Submission:  On line 681 and 822 in 
addressbook/inc/class.uiaddressbook.inc.php, you try to merge some arrays by 
using "+". I'm not sure if this is correct. It results in this error on my 
system:
[Sun May  5 15:36:55 2002] [error] PHP Fatal error:  Unsupported operand types 
in /usr/share/phpgroupware/addressbook/inc/class.uiaddressbook.inc.php on line 
822

This can be fixed by using the array_merge function instead.
